Why do users specifically look for version 4.6.3? In the world of software cracking, older versions are often targeted because their security protocols are easier to bypass than newer versions. Hackers and "crackers" create patches or key generators for these specific builds, and these versions persist on file-sharing sites and forums long after the developer has moved on to newer iterations. However, using an antiquated version of recovery software comes with its own set of technical failures. File systems change (exFAT, NTFS, APFS), and storage technology evolves (SSDs vs. HDDs). A recovery tool from the era of version 4.6.3 may not be optimized for modern hardware, potentially resulting in a failed recovery even if the user manages to activate it.
